ROME, Ga. - Centre men's golf entered the last of three rounds at the Chick-Fil-A Invitational in tenth place and they capped off their final tournament of the fall with a tenth place finish.
In a close middle of the leaderboard, Centre finished one shot back of Sewanee and three back of LaGrange while finishing four shots ahead of Virginia Wesleyan.
Individually, freshman
Peyton Toon kept the momentum from his round of 70 to finish off Monday by shooting even par 72 on Tuesday, landing in eighth place overall with a 54-hole score of 218. Toon was rock solid on Tuesday, recording with 16 pars and shooting birdie on the par 4 10th hole near the end of his round.
Harrison Akers joined Toon in the overall top 25 as he shot 77 on Tuesday to cap off his tournament with a two-day score of 225, good for 24th place overall.
Charlie Reber and
Ben Bevington posted respective tournament scores of 234 and 235 as Reber shot 77 on Tuesday and Bevington shot 79 in his final round
Andrew Mainka rounded out Centre's Tuesday totals with a score of 80, including consecutive birdies near the turn on 2 and 3. He finished with a tournament score of 248.
